Most auto insurance companies will not insure a driver without a valid Oregon driver's license, but a few will. Oregon law states that you have 30 days to obtain a license in this State from the date of your move. The DMV and police encountered difficulty enforcing that requirement in 2020, as the branches were closed for much of the year. Then, when they reopened, setting an appointment to get a license proved challenging. Until this year, only documented citizens and residents could secure an Oregon driver’s license. The rules have changed, and anyone, regardless of documentation status, who can prove they live in this state may now apply for a driver’s license. That jammed up the appointment queue.
